Art & Design; Printmaking - Collagraphy

Collagraphy (collography) is a printmaking technique in which materials are applied to a board or piece of wood to create a raised design. The area is then covered with a layer of ink or paint depending on choice and placed onto a printing press. A printable material is then placed over your board and the press is turned, this then passes the work through pressing the inked design onto the material, this creates an impression of your design. This resulting print is termed a Collagraph.
